Commit Graph

254 Commits (ec897be3e76fd45fe5eeef03259020197953a471)

Author SHA1 Message Date
barisusakli f89741636c return false to prevent default
barisusakli ca31ac882c added return true/false
Julian Lam 40763d2ae7 again
Julian Lam 57a64870fd actually fixing
Barış Soner Uşaklı 53e0615df7 removed path use external
Barış Soner Uşaklı 4d45a81fdb closes
psychobunny e47c375e69 closes
barisusakli e5dc408ef5 change current page after ajaxify:start event
barisusakli f87f797bed dont keep window.location.search on regular ajaxify
barisusakli 289474edf7 closes
barisusakli 63a6702285 removed whitespace
barisusakli 23a6b33f64 not used
barisusakli 2a8437f08f removed templates config and mapping 🐑
Julian Lam 00f3084b8e closes , closes , closes , closes , closes , closes , closes , closes
Squashed commit of the following:

commit ca5064a4effa3904ce936b521b169bba8d24f1a1
Author: Julian Lam <julian@designcreateplay.com>
Date:   Thu Feb 26 08:19:32 2015 -0500

    Revert "added ajaxify popstate cache, so back/forward will just put back the already loaded page"

    This reverts commit 77d154bb8b.

commit ae07fc56c156074de8048bb627f5d9be849c8ad1
Author: Julian Lam <julian@designcreateplay.com>
Date:   Thu Feb 26 08:19:24 2015 -0500

    Revert "on click, topics are marked read from the unread page. Also fixed an issue where isPopState kept getting set to true, causing issues"

    This reverts commit d8c9ec0d40.

    Conflicts:
    	public/src/client/unread.js

commit 96ee3631d7e4e1fc2c1b7632d86684fecd1e430f
Author: Julian Lam <julian@designcreateplay.com>
Date:   Thu Feb 26 08:18:25 2015 -0500

    Revert "actually fixed isPopState error"

    This reverts commit e6701c5a1f.
psychobunny 26245133f3 linted client-side core modules
Julian Lam e6701c5a1f actually fixed isPopState error
Julian Lam d8c9ec0d40 on click, topics are marked read from the unread page. Also fixed an issue where isPopState kept getting set to true, causing issues
Julian Lam 77d154bb8b added ajaxify popstate cache, so back/forward will just put back the already loaded page
Julian Lam 8a581ed1dd fixes :rage2:
Julian Lam 57d45518bd added a preventDefault when href="#" or data-ajaxify="false", so page doesn't send user back to top (which is kind of annoying), but not sure if this may introduce side-effects. @barisusakli @psychobunny
barisusakli 200f74f1c7 closes
barisusakli bbfec7d443 fix post index parse
barisusakli 08c1dad3ee topics.isFollowing works with multiple tids now
psychobunny a7d73d4106 fixes adding new routes to user/xxx/route
psychobunny 5ee0ed401f fixed ajaxify's redirecting to external URLs.. well fixed redirecting in general
Julian Lam b278f27ffe partial fix to
barisusakli ddd6ed9e8c 403 page
barisusakli be11577aa4 closes
barisusakli 47c1092842 moved registerLoader/refresh to top
barisusakli 776fb29dce removed preloader leftovers
psychobunny 45affa3043 closes
barisusakli 7a51520074
barisusakli 0ede4abe18 possible fix for
barisusakli 7de9b998b5 fix typo in ajaxify, closes
psychobunny ed60deb3f5 fixed ACP from previous commit
barisusakli 43806e5921 replay ie host fix
https://github.com/NodeBB/NodeBB/pull/2216
Julian Lam dedf7a6715 closed
psychobunny 15052143d3 that preloader, will blow up your datacenter.
barisusakli 0dc780148a removed global room
socket.io already puts everyone into a room named ''
Julian Lam 063a4e5628 finished up UX integration for in-topic searching, added mousetrap lib to capture ctrl-F only in topic view, closed
Julian Lam 347d7de25b an ajaxify.go 302 will pass callback and quiet arguments along as well now
Julian Lam e497290dbc removed commented-out code
Julian Lam fcbdc5e271 added recompilation of templates to NodeBB Reloading -
Julian Lam 5936c72f96 further fix to
barisusakli 53d20cf058 parse variables before rendering widgets
psychobunny 193832ea9b closes
psychobunny a880ac6e9f do one api call for template configs rather than two on cold load
barisusakli 4fd2973c53 closes
barisusakli e0be4d146f closes
barisusakli 8146358aac closes
fixed translator.load, it wasn't passing in language and was trying to
load undefined.json